The Des Moines Astronomical Society is pleased to invite you to attend the
 
Annual Astronomical League Convention and Exposition
 
in the heart of the heartland, Des Moines, Iowa...A city made for walking!




 
Many walking bridges and trails are available within the area.



 
An expansive climate controlled skywalk system links throughout the central city.
Come rain or shine it's always a delight navigating the city through the skywalks!


Please join the members of DMAS, the Astronomical League, and the Association of Lunar
Planetary Observers (ALPO) for a shared convention and weekend filled with
blue skies, clean air, good food, and plenty of Iowan hospitality.

Flood Update
Greater Des Moines Open for Business

Des Moines is open!  It's business as usual.  Community support and collaboration from city and
county officials helped prevent major flooding issues throughout Downtown Des Moines.
Your convention chairman says "We're high and dry and ready for July!"
